Output 8814270950a9b5055cdcbf4029f23d619931539f6849ac60890e9e3c3ffe3ef8:352

value
11682997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8b5efaefd1233310b99ee9851ec6f97d5332bb OP_EQUAL
address
MU6aXVXhs3GWT1EgAP11cvBZ2JWKNmYBqg
transaction
8814270950a9b5055cdcbf4029f23d619931539f6849ac60890e9e3c3ffe3ef8
spent
true